P1447 Code BMW: EVAP Control System

The P1447 code in BMW vehicles is related to the EVAP control system. This diagnostic trouble code indicates a problem with the EVAP system, which is responsible for controlling the emission of fuel vapors from the vehicle’s fuel tank.
Understanding the P1447 Code
The P1447 code specifically refers to a leak detection module heater circuit malfunction in the EVAP system. This can lead to issues with the vehicle’s emissions and overall performance.
Common Causes of the P1447 Code
There are several common reasons why the P1447 code may appear in BMW vehicles. These include a faulty leak detection module, issues with the heater circuit, or a malfunctioning purge valve.
Symptoms of the P1447 Code
When the P1447 code is triggered, drivers may notice symptoms such as the check engine light coming on, decreased fuel efficiency, or a noticeable fuel smell coming from the vehicle.
